Understanding the Hinesville Job Market
Hinesville, GA, presents a dynamic job market driven by a variety of industries. The presence of Fort Stewart significantly influences the local economy, creating numerous job opportunities directly and indirectly related to military activities. Here’s a closer look:
Key Industries in Hinesville
The job market in Hinesville is diverse, with several key sectors driving employment:
- Military and Defense: Fort Stewart is the primary employer, offering jobs in military support, logistics, and administration.
- Healthcare: Hospitals, clinics, and healthcare facilities provide a range of positions from medical professionals to support staff.
- Retail and Hospitality: Numerous retail stores, restaurants, and hotels support the local economy, creating many customer service and management positions.
- Education: Schools and educational institutions offer opportunities for teachers, administrators, and support staff.
- Government and Public Service: Local government agencies provide various roles in administration, public safety, and infrastructure.

Military and Defense Jobs
Fort Stewart offers a vast array of jobs, including:
- Military Support: Positions related to base operations, logistics, and administration.
- Contractors: Opportunities for companies that support military operations, providing services like IT, security, and maintenance.
- Civilian Roles: Various civilian jobs within the military installation, from administrative support to technical roles. Many are looking for "military jobs near Hinesville GA".
